Post-burned auricular keloids are a challenging problem for the patient and physician. We describe a successful combined treatment of a bulky post -burn auricular keloid employing intralesional cryosurgery followed by multiple W-Plasty. An EAR-Q™ pre- and post-operative patient-reported outcome assessments have revealed a significant improvement in all ear parameters of appearance, adverse effects and quality of life. This combined treatment might be added to the armamentarium of possible treatment modalities to this perplexing problem.
